Totals betting, also known as over\/under betting, is a popular type of wager in sports betting. This form of betting focuses on predicting the combined total score of a game rather than the outcome of the match itself. This article provides a simple explanation of totals betting and offers tips on how to approach this type of wager.<\/p>\n\n\n\n
In totals betting, sportsbooks set a predetermined number representing the combined total score for both teams in a game. Bettors then place wagers on whether the actual total score will be over or under the set number. It’s important to note that totals betting is available for various sports, including football, basketball, baseball, and soccer.<\/p>\n\n\n\n
Odds for totals betting are typically expressed in American odds format, where a positive or negative number indicates the amount you can win for every $100 wagered. For example, if the odds for an over bet are -110, you would need to bet $110 to win $100. The odds for under bets are usually similar, as sportsbooks aim to balance the action on both sides of the wager.<\/p>\n\n\n\n

In totals betting, it’s crucial to pay attention to line movement, which refers to changes in the set total number as bets are placed. Line movement can provide insights into how the betting public and oddsmakers view the game, helping you make more informed decisions when placing your wagers.<\/p>\n\n\n\n
Live betting, also known as in-play betting, allows bettors to place wagers on totals during the game as the total score changes. Live betting can offer additional opportunities for bettors to capitalize on their knowledge of the game and adapt their bets based on the in-game action.<\/p>\n\n\n\n
When engaging in totals betting, it’s essential to practice proper bankroll management. Set limits for your betting activity and stick to a consistent unit size, ensuring you don’t risk more than you can afford to lose.<\/p>\n\n\n\n
